Output 59bc8736bdddfb6f5c40ca1b8f6d689e2395ef55708d0891edeb084e342f72f5:0

value
501905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b994c0883ecb3bb34f67cbecf4cd5129d38b4688 OP_EQUAL
address
3JcH8WREHTL3ptNgzSJAQZCLuQJREyvXVM
transaction
59bc8736bdddfb6f5c40ca1b8f6d689e2395ef55708d0891edeb084e342f72f5
confirmations
140303
spent
true